Duties
- Conduct psychological evaluations and assessments for students in educational settings, utilizing standardized testing and observational techniques.
- Collaborate with educators, parents, and other professionals to gather relevant information regarding student performance and behavior.
- Prepare detailed reports outlining assessment findings, diagnoses, and recommended interventions or accommodations.
- Provide expert consultation on special education needs, behavioral strategies, and support plans for students with diverse learning challenges.
- Maintain accurate documentation of assessment procedures, results, and follow-up actions in compliance with legal and ethical standards.
- Participate in multidisciplinary team meetings to discuss assessment outcomes and assist in developing individualized education programs (IEPs).
- Stay current with research developments in educational psychology, special education, and related fields to ensure best practices are applied.
